Current management of congenital anterior cranial base encephaloceles

Background:

  • Congenital encephaloceles present significant diagnostic and surgical challenges in pediatric patients.
  • Effective management requires a thorough understanding of presentation, surgical techniques, and outcomes.

Purpose of the Study:

  • To evaluate contemporary endoscopic treatment strategies for congenital encephaloceles.
  • To analyze presentation, surgical techniques, and patient outcomes.

Main Methods:

  • Retrospective chart review of 14 patients with 15 congenital encephaloceles treated between 2003 and 2019.
  • Data collected included demographics, symptoms, associated anomalies, surgical details, and complications.

Main Results:

  • Endoscopic repair was performed on patients aged 2 months to 22 years, with a mean follow-up of 23 months.
  • Nasal obstruction was the most common presentation; cerebrospinal fluid (CSF) leak was rare.
  • Average encephalocele size was 2.44 cm with a mean skull base defect of 8.6 x 7.7 mm.

Conclusions:

  • Endoscopic techniques are safe and effective for repairing congenital encephaloceles in pediatric patients.
  • Early intervention is feasible, with successful repairs in infants as young as two months.
  • Endoscopic approaches provide a viable alternative to traditional open surgeries.
